Understanding Hands-on Handling

What is Hands-on Handling?

Manual handling describes any task that involves training, reducing, pushing, drawing, lugging, or moving things by hand or bodily force. The tasks range from straightforward jobs like lifting a box from the ground to more complex circumstances entailing mechanical aids.

Why is Manual Handling Important?

The primary reason manual handling is so critical lies in its direct connection with work environment security. According to stats from Safe Job Australia, musculoskeletal problems (MSDs) arising from inappropriate hands-on handling are among the leading root causes of work environment injuries. Correct training can considerably reduce these risks.

Common Handbook Handling Injuries

Back Injuries: Frequently arising from inappropriate training techniques. Shoulder Strains: Triggered by repeated overhead lifts. Knee Injuries: Resulting from awkward bending. Wrist Pressures: Associated with recurring motions. Ankle Strains: Triggered by unsteady surfaces while lugging loads.

Each injury type has its unique implications for recovery time and monetary prices entailed for both staff members and employers.

Techniques for Safe Handbook Handling

Lifting Techniques

Position Your Feet: Keep your feet shoulder-width apart for balance. Bend Your Knees: Bow down instead of flexing at your waist. Keep the Load Close: Maintain close contact between your body and the load. Lift With Your Legs: Use your leg muscular tissues instead of your when lifting. Avoid Twisting Your Body: Transform your whole body rather than turning at the waist.

Carrying Techniques

    When bring a things: Ensure you can see where you're going. Balance the load evenly on both sides if applicable.

Pushing and Drawing Techniques

    Use your body weight to press rather than putting in force with your arms alone. When pulling a things in the direction of you, keep it near your body.
